Where We Find Our Pieces

Some days in the vintage world are utterly fruitless. Hours of rummaging, driving, digging, only to come home with empty hands and sad hearts. And then there are the spectacular days, the ones where a single shelf or forgotten box reveals a treasure that makes your heart skip.



Finding vintage is always a dance between luck and legwork, a mix of being in the right place at the right time and doing the dog work no one sees. It’s early mornings, long drives, quiet intuition, and the thrill of discovery woven together, and it’s that unpredictability that makes the hunt so addictive and so rewarding.


We search:

- country markets

- estate collections

- artisan studios

- private sellers

- regional auctions

- forgotten cupboards

- old potters’ sheds

Every piece has its own journey.

How We Restore

We restore with a light hand:

- gentle cleaning

- textile laundering

- wood oiling

- crystal polishing

- research into maker and era

We never erase history. We honour it.
